What it means

A menty b is a mental breakdown, said lightly and half-jokingly about a small meltdown over everyday stress. Five unread emails and a flat tyre and you are having a full menty b.

Usage examples

"The printer jammed again and I had a little menty b."
"She is having a menty b over the seating plan, give her a minute."
Tone
Funny Over-the-top

Where it comes from

Cutesy shortening of mental breakdown to menty b, defusing the heaviness by making the whole thing sound almost playful.
